Why UNLV Will Win
This is a game that should play right into UNLV’s hand. The rebuilding Lobos prefer to play a high paced, up and down game, which is when the Rebels are playing at their best. On top of that, it’s looking like the Lobos will be without two of their best players in Sam Longwood and Troy Simmons, leaving them with only eight players.
Also, both Jovan Mooring and Jordan Johnson appear to have ended their mid season shooting/scoring slumps, so if they can pick up where they left off against Air Force, that will go a long way in opening up the paint, and allowing Brandon McCoy and Shakur Juiston to exploit the less talented Lobos front court.
Why new mexico Will Win
In each of UNLV’s two wins this conference season, they have looked underwhelming, on both the offensive and defensive ends of the court. And New Mexico may be short handed, but they are going to play hard. In their previous loss to Fresno State, they held a 6 point lead with under eight minutes to go, before fading down the stretch.
Freshman Makuach Maluach, has been shinning in his expanded roll, scoring in double figures in each of his last three games. If the Rebels struggles on the defensive end continue, an upset isn’t out of the realm of possibilities.
